Did you recently install the Java version 7? Here is a possible solution worth trying: CODE To resolve the issue with the latest update of Java, please try the following:
(You must close all browsers first before doing this) 1. Open your computers control panel. 2. Double click the java coffee cup. 3. Click the "Settings" button. 4. Click the "Delete Files" button. 5. Check ALL things to be deleted including "Installed Applications and Applets". 6. Click "OK" Once you've done this open your browser and see if it works. -------------------- For GMC support please email support (at) guitarmasterclass.net
